数据库软件如何工作

时间:2025-01-17 16:12:21 网游攻略

数据库软件的工作流程可以概括为以下几个主要步骤:

需求分析

明确项目的需求,包括功能需求、性能需求、安全需求等。

这通常通过与用户和利益相关者进行沟通来实现,确保对需求有清晰的理解。

设计阶段

概念设计:设计数据库的整体结构和功能模块。

逻辑设计:设计数据库的逻辑结构,包括表的设计、索引的设计等。

物理设计:根据逻辑设计,选择合适的存储结构和访问方式,优化数据库的性能。

开发阶段

数据库创建:根据设计阶段的结果,创建数据库和表。

数据录入:将必要的数据录入到数据库中。

功能开发:根据需求开发数据库的功能,如查询、更新、删除等操作。

测试阶段

单元测试:对每个模块进行测试,确保其功能正常。

集成测试:测试各个模块之间的交互是否正常。

性能测试:测试数据库的性能,确保其能够满足性能需求。

部署和维护阶段

部署:将开发完成的数据库部署到生产环境中。

维护:定期对数据库进行维护,包括数据备份、安全检查等。

数据库软件的功能和特点包括:

数据存储:提供可靠、高效的数据存储机制,确保数据的安全性和完整性。

数据检索:用户可以轻松检索所需的数据,提高数据访问的效率。

数据管理:支持数据的增、删、改等操作,提供数据备份和恢复功能。

数据共享:多个用户可以同时访问数据库,共享数据资源,提高数据的使用效率。

通过以上步骤和功能特点,可以全面地开发和维护一个高效的数据库软件系统。